To continue quoting from the description of Volf's book: Most proposed solutions to the problem of exclusion have focused on social arrangements: what kind of society ought we to create in order to accommodate individual or communal difference? Activity 2: Move It! Part I - A Circle That Kept Me Out | Faithful Journeys | Tapestry of Faith. Jump right into the poem with your children. It is easy to assume that "exclusion" is the problem or practice of "barbarians" who live "over there, " but Volf persuades us that exclusion is all too often our practice "here" as well. Otherness, the simple fact of being different in some way, has come to be defined as in and of itself evil... Increasingly we see that exclusion has become the primary sin, skewing our perceptions of reality and causing us to react out of fear and anger to all those who are not within our (ever-narrowing) circle... Exclusion happens, Volf argues, wherever impenetrable barriers are set up that prevent a creative encounter with the other.
